A LifeStraw is only useful if it is on you when you find the water. Loose in a pack it collects grit in the mouthpiece and ends up at the bottom under everything else. This pouch is cut to hold two LifeStraws upright and keeps them clean, so the filter you drink through has not been rolling around in the dirt of a cargo drawer.
Hand-sewn from 1000D Cordura and cut close to the straw so the filters do not rattle inside. It mounts two ways: MOLLE webbing on the back weaves onto a PALS grid — a seat organizer, a MOLLE panel, a pack — for a permanent flat mount, or use the clip attachment when you want it on a belt loop or a shoulder strap and want it off again in a second. Two straws in one pouch means the second person on the hike is not sharing yours.

What to know before you buy
Pouch only. The filters are sold separately. It is cut for the standard LifeStraw personal filter — the larger bottle and gravity versions are a different shape.
